문제

JFILECHOOSER FILETYPE (저장시)를 어떻게 시행 할 수 있습니까? 파일 필터 (CSV Filetype)를 구현했지만 사용자의 파일 확장자를 시행하지는 않습니다.

사용자가 그렇게하지 않은 경우 파일 확장자를 파일 이름에 추가하려면 파일 선택기가 필요합니다. 사용자가 파일을 선택한 후 파일 확장자에 대해 filechooser.getSelectedFile ()를 확인할 수 있다고 생각하지만 기존 파일을 덮어 쓰는 것은 발생할 수 있습니다.

도움이 되었습니까?

해결책

getSelectedFile ()을 호출 한 결과에 확장을 추가하는 제안은 내가 접근하는 방법입니다. 조치가 기존 파일을 덮어 쓰는 경우 확인 대화 상자가있는 사용자에게 촉구됩니다. 나는 많은 응용 프로그램 이이 접근법을 취하는 것을 보았으므로 사용자에게 상당히 직관적이라고 말할 것입니다.

라이센스 : CC-BY-SA ~와 함께 속성
제휴하지 않습니다 StackOverflow
scroll top